[GIT PULL] arch/tile updates for 3.1

From: Chris Metcalf
Date: Tue Aug 02 2011 - 16:55:56 EST


Linus,

Please pull for 3.1 from:

git://git.kernel.org/pub/scm/linux/kernel/git/cmetcalf/linux-tile.git master

These are a set of relatively minor changes for arch/tile, including a
new character driver to support the standard boot device (a SPI flash ROM).
Thanks!

Chris Metcalf (6):
tile: use generic-y format for one-line asm-generic headers
ioctl-number.txt: add the tile hardwall ioctl range
arch/tile: add hypervisor-based character driver for SPI flash ROM
arch/tile: remove useless set_fixmap_nocache() macro

John Stultz (1):
clocksource: tile: convert to use clocksource_register_hz

Julia Lawall (1):
arch/tile/mm/init.c: trivial: use BUG_ON

Documentation/ioctl/ioctl-number.txt | 1 +
arch/tile/include/asm/Kbuild | 38 +++
arch/tile/include/asm/bug.h | 1 -
arch/tile/include/asm/bugs.h | 1 -
arch/tile/include/asm/cputime.h | 1 -
arch/tile/include/asm/device.h | 1 -
arch/tile/include/asm/div64.h | 1 -
arch/tile/include/asm/emergency-restart.h | 1 -
arch/tile/include/asm/errno.h | 1 -
arch/tile/include/asm/fb.h | 1 -
arch/tile/include/asm/fcntl.h | 1 -
arch/tile/include/asm/fixmap.h | 6 -
arch/tile/include/asm/ioctl.h | 1 -
arch/tile/include/asm/ioctls.h | 1 -
arch/tile/include/asm/ipc.h | 1 -
arch/tile/include/asm/ipcbuf.h | 1 -
arch/tile/include/asm/irq_regs.h | 1 -
arch/tile/include/asm/kdebug.h | 1 -
arch/tile/include/asm/local.h | 1 -
arch/tile/include/asm/module.h | 1 -
arch/tile/include/asm/msgbuf.h | 1 -
arch/tile/include/asm/mutex.h | 1 -
arch/tile/include/asm/param.h | 1 -
arch/tile/include/asm/parport.h | 1 -
arch/tile/include/asm/poll.h | 1 -
arch/tile/include/asm/posix_types.h | 1 -
arch/tile/include/asm/resource.h | 1 -
arch/tile/include/asm/scatterlist.h | 1 -
arch/tile/include/asm/sembuf.h | 1 -
arch/tile/include/asm/serial.h | 1 -
arch/tile/include/asm/shmbuf.h | 1 -
arch/tile/include/asm/shmparam.h | 1 -
arch/tile/include/asm/socket.h | 1 -
arch/tile/include/asm/sockios.h | 1 -
arch/tile/include/asm/statfs.h | 1 -
arch/tile/include/asm/termbits.h | 1 -
arch/tile/include/asm/termios.h | 1 -
arch/tile/include/asm/types.h | 1 -
arch/tile/include/asm/ucontext.h | 1 -
arch/tile/include/asm/xor.h | 1 -
arch/tile/include/hv/drv_srom_intf.h | 41 +++
arch/tile/kernel/time.c | 5 +-
arch/tile/mm/init.c | 3 +-
drivers/char/Kconfig | 11 +
drivers/char/Makefile | 2 +
drivers/char/tile-srom.c | 481 +++++++++++++++++++++++++++++
46 files changed, 576 insertions(+), 49 deletions(-)
delete mode 100644 arch/tile/include/asm/bug.h
delete mode 100644 arch/tile/include/asm/bugs.h
delete mode 100644 arch/tile/include/asm/cputime.h
delete mode 100644 arch/tile/include/asm/device.h
delete mode 100644 arch/tile/include/asm/div64.h
delete mode 100644 arch/tile/include/asm/emergency-restart.h
delete mode 100644 arch/tile/include/asm/errno.h
delete mode 100644 arch/tile/include/asm/fb.h
delete mode 100644 arch/tile/include/asm/fcntl.h
delete mode 100644 arch/tile/include/asm/ioctl.h
delete mode 100644 arch/tile/include/asm/ioctls.h
delete mode 100644 arch/tile/include/asm/ipc.h
delete mode 100644 arch/tile/include/asm/ipcbuf.h
delete mode 100644 arch/tile/include/asm/irq_regs.h
delete mode 100644 arch/tile/include/asm/kdebug.h
delete mode 100644 arch/tile/include/asm/local.h
delete mode 100644 arch/tile/include/asm/module.h
delete mode 100644 arch/tile/include/asm/msgbuf.h
delete mode 100644 arch/tile/include/asm/mutex.h
delete mode 100644 arch/tile/include/asm/param.h
delete mode 100644 arch/tile/include/asm/parport.h
delete mode 100644 arch/tile/include/asm/poll.h
delete mode 100644 arch/tile/include/asm/posix_types.h
delete mode 100644 arch/tile/include/asm/resource.h
delete mode 100644 arch/tile/include/asm/scatterlist.h
delete mode 100644 arch/tile/include/asm/sembuf.h
delete mode 100644 arch/tile/include/asm/serial.h
delete mode 100644 arch/tile/include/asm/shmbuf.h
delete mode 100644 arch/tile/include/asm/shmparam.h
delete mode 100644 arch/tile/include/asm/socket.h
delete mode 100644 arch/tile/include/asm/sockios.h
delete mode 100644 arch/tile/include/asm/statfs.h
delete mode 100644 arch/tile/include/asm/termbits.h
delete mode 100644 arch/tile/include/asm/termios.h
delete mode 100644 arch/tile/include/asm/types.h
delete mode 100644 arch/tile/include/asm/ucontext.h
delete mode 100644 arch/tile/include/asm/xor.h
create mode 100644 arch/tile/include/hv/drv_srom_intf.h
create mode 100644 drivers/char/tile-srom.c


--
Chris Metcalf, Tilera Corp.
http://www.tilera.com

--
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/